Webbph2simon returns a list with pu, pa, alpha, beta and nmax as above and: out. matrix of best 2 stage designs for each value of total sample size n. the 6 columns are: r1, n1, r, n, EN (p0), PET (p0) Trial is stopped early if <= r1 responses are seen in the first stage and treatment is considered desirable only when >r responses seen.

Webb28 juli 2024 · Among the candidate two-stage designs, the Simon’s (1986) minimax design has the smallest maximal sample size n and the optimal design has the smallest expected sample size under H0 : p = p0, EN(p0).
